轻松连接虚拟主机与Facebook:提升品牌曝光与用户体验
卡尔云官网
www.kaeryun.com
1. 了解虚拟主机与Facebook平台
1.1 虚拟主机的基本概念
想象一下,你有一个很酷的网站,里面充满了你的创意和内容。但是,这个网站要怎么让大家都能访问到呢?这就需要用到虚拟主机。简单来说,虚拟主机就像是你的网站的家,它提供了一个稳定的网络环境,让你的网站能够24小时在线,随时被访问。
虚拟主机就像是一个大房子,里面可以住很多家庭,每个家庭都有自己的房间,但共享同一个屋顶。在虚拟主机的世界里,每个网站就像是一个家庭,有自己的空间,但都住在同一个服务器上。
1.2 Facebook平台概述
Facebook,这个大家都很熟悉的名字,它不仅仅是一个社交平台,更是一个强大的营销工具。想象一下,你可以在Facebook上建立自己的品牌页面,和粉丝互动,发布动态,甚至还能进行广告投放。这就是Facebook平台。
Facebook平台就像是你的网站的一个大广场,你可以在这里展示你的产品,和更多的人交流,让你的品牌被更多人知道。
2. 虚拟主机连接Facebook的必要性
2.1 为什么要通过虚拟主机连接Facebook
首先,我们要明白,虚拟主机和Facebook平台各有各的作用。虚拟主机是你的网站的家,而Facebook则是一个巨大的社交网络。那么,将这两者连接起来,有什么必要性呢?
提升品牌曝光度:通过虚拟主机连接Facebook,你的网站可以更容易地被Facebook上的用户发现。想象一下,你的网站就像是一本书,而Facebook就像是图书馆,连接两者可以让更多人有机会翻阅你的“书籍”。
增强用户体验:用户在Facebook上看到你的内容,点击链接直接访问你的网站,这样的用户体验要比用户直接在浏览器中输入网址要好得多。虚拟主机保证了网站的速度和稳定性,让用户体验更加顺畅。
拓展营销渠道:Facebook作为一个强大的营销平台,通过虚拟主机连接,可以让你更有效地进行广告投放和内容营销,扩大你的潜在客户群体。
2.2 连接带来的优势分析
连接虚拟主机和Facebook,不仅能提升品牌曝光度和用户体验,还能带来以下优势:
数据整合:通过连接,你可以将Facebook上的用户数据与你的网站数据整合,更好地了解用户行为,优化营销策略。
互动性增强:用户可以在Facebook上对你的内容进行评论、点赞和分享,这些互动可以直接影响到你的网站流量和用户粘性。
SEO优化:通过Facebook分享你的网站内容,可以提高网站的搜索引擎排名,增加网站的可见度。
多渠道营销:连接虚拟主机和Facebook,可以实现多渠道营销,让你的品牌在多个平台上展现,提高品牌影响力。
总之,虚拟主机连接Facebook,就像是给你的网站装上了翅膀,让它能够飞得更高、更远。这样的连接,对于想要在互联网上建立品牌、拓展业务的人来说,是必不可少的。
3. 准备工作
3.1 获取虚拟主机服务
在开始连接虚拟主机与Facebook之前,你需要先拥有一台虚拟主机。虚拟主机就像是你在线上的一个办公室,你的网站内容就存放在这里。以下是获取虚拟主机服务的一些步骤:
选择虚拟主机服务商:市面上有很多虚拟主机服务商,比如阿里云、腾讯云、百度云等。选择一个信誉好、服务优质的提供商是第一步。
购买虚拟主机:根据你的需求选择合适的虚拟主机类型,比如共享主机、VPS主机等。购买时要注意服务器的配置,如CPU、内存、存储空间等。
域名解析:购买虚拟主机后,你需要将你的域名解析到虚拟主机服务商提供的IP地址上。这样,用户通过输入你的域名就能访问到你的网站。
3.2 注册Facebook应用程序
为了连接Facebook,你需要先注册一个Facebook应用程序。以下是注册步骤:
登录Facebook开发者账户:如果你还没有Facebook开发者账户,需要先注册一个。登录后,进入Facebook开发者中心。
创建应用程序:在开发者中心,点击“我的应用”,然后选择“新建应用”。填写应用名称、描述等信息,创建应用。
获取App ID和App Secret:创建应用后,你会看到应用的详细信息页面。在这里,你可以找到App ID和App Secret,这两个信息在后续连接过程中会用到。
完成以上准备工作后,你就可以开始虚拟主机连接Facebook的下一步了。接下来的步骤将详细介绍如何设置虚拟主机环境、获取Facebook应用程序凭证、配置Facebook API以及集成Facebook API到虚拟主机。
4. 连接步骤详解
4.1 设置虚拟主机环境
4.1.1 选择合适的虚拟主机服务
在准备工作完成后,我们就要进入实操阶段了。首先,你需要选择一个合适的虚拟主机服务。这里有几个点要注意:
- 服务稳定性:选择一个稳定的服务商,你的网站才能保证24小时在线。
- 支持语言:确保虚拟主机支持你将要使用的编程语言,比如PHP、Python等。
- 扩展性:随着业务的发展,你的虚拟主机应该能方便地升级配置。
4.1.2 配置虚拟主机环境
虚拟主机配置通常包括以下几个步骤:
- 安装服务器软件:根据你的需求,可能需要安装Apache、Nginx等服务器软件。
- 安装数据库:MySQL、PostgreSQL等数据库是网站后端数据存储的基石。
- 安装相关软件包:比如PHP、Python、Node.js等,这些都是构建网站必不可少的。
4.2 获取Facebook应用程序凭证
4.2.1 登录Facebook开发者账户
现在,你需要在Facebook开发者中心登录你的账户。如果你还没有账户,需要先创建一个。
4.2.2 创建应用程序并获取App ID和App Secret
- 进入开发者中心:登录后,点击“我的应用”,选择“新建应用”。
- 填写应用信息:填写应用名称、描述等基本信息。
- 获取App ID和App Secret:创建应用后,在应用的详细信息页面,你会看到App ID和App Secret,这两个是连接的关键。
4.3 配置Facebook API
4.3.1 在Facebook开发者中心启用所需API
- 选择应用:在开发者中心,找到你刚才创建的应用。
- 设置权限:进入“设置”选项卡,选择“基本”然后点击“添加平台”。
- 启用API:选择“网站”,然后勾选你需要的API。
4.3.2 获取API访问权限
- 添加权限:回到“设置”选项卡,选择“权限”。
- 选择权限:勾选你需要访问的权限,如公共权限、用户权限等。
4.4 集成Facebook API到虚拟主机
4.4.1 安装API集成工具
根据你的编程语言和框架,可能需要安装一些API集成工具,比如Facebook SDK。
4.4.2 编写代码实现API调用
- 初始化SDK:在代码中引入SDK,并进行初始化。
- 调用API:根据需求,调用相应的API,如获取用户信息、发布动态等。
通过以上步骤,你就可以将Facebook与虚拟主机连接起来,实现数据的交互和功能的集成。
5. 集成测试与优化
5.1 进行初步集成测试
当你完成Facebook API与虚拟主机的集成后,接下来的步骤是进行集成测试。这个过程就像是给你的网站进行一次全面的体检,确保一切都能正常运作。
5.1.1 功能测试
首先,进行功能测试。检查你是否能成功调用Facebook的API,比如发送消息、获取用户数据等。这个阶段,你可以使用一些测试工具,比如Postman,来模拟API调用。
5.1.2 性能测试
性能测试同样重要,特别是对于面向大量用户的网站。检查你的网站在处理大量请求时,是否能够稳定运行,响应速度是否满足要求。
5.2 优化集成效果
在初步测试完成后,接下来是优化阶段。
5.2.1 提升用户体验
用户体验是网站成功的关键。确保你的集成功能简单易用,用户在使用过程中不会遇到任何难题。
5.2.2 安全性加固
网络安全是重中之重。检查你的集成过程中是否涉及敏感数据,比如用户密码、个人信息等,确保这些数据的安全。
5.2.3 资源优化
优化网站的性能,减少资源消耗。比如,对于图片、视频等大文件,可以采用压缩技术,减少传输时间。
5.3 持续监控与迭代
集成完成并优化后,并不意味着工作就此结束。你需要持续监控网站的表现,一旦发现问题,及时进行迭代优化。
- 监控API调用情况:定期检查API的调用情况,确保没有异常。
- 用户反馈:收集用户反馈,了解他们在使用过程中的体验,根据反馈进行改进。
通过这些步骤,你不仅能够确保Facebook与虚拟主机的集成稳定、高效,还能为用户提供更好的服务体验。
6. 遇到的问题及解决方案
6.1 常见问题分析
6.1.1 虚拟主机配置错误
在使用虚拟主机连接Facebook时,最常见的问题之一就是配置错误。这可能是由于DNS设置不正确、服务器防火墙规则设置不当或者服务器环境不符合要求等原因造成的。
6.1.2 Facebook API权限问题
另一个常见问题是与Facebook API权限相关。有时候,你可能无法获取到所需的API权限,这可能是由于你的Facebook应用程序设置不正确,或者权限请求被拒绝。
6.1.3 集成过程中的代码错误
集成过程中,代码错误也是一个常见问题。这可能是因为API调用参数错误、数据处理逻辑错误或者代码逻辑错误等原因导致的。
6.2 解决方案提供
6.2.1 虚拟主机配置错误
- 检查DNS设置:确保你的域名解析正确,DNS记录指向正确的虚拟主机IP地址。
- 调整防火墙规则:如果防火墙阻止了API请求,尝试放宽规则或者添加新的规则允许API访问。
- 确认服务器环境:确保服务器环境满足Facebook API的要求,比如PHP版本、数据库类型等。
6.2.2 Facebook API权限问题
- 检查应用程序设置:确保你的Facebook应用程序正确设置了权限,并且权限请求被批准。
- 联系Facebook支持:如果权限请求被拒绝,可以联系Facebook支持团队寻求帮助。
6.2.3 集成过程中的代码错误
- 仔细检查代码:使用调试工具检查代码,找出错误的原因。
- 查阅文档:参考Facebook API的官方文档,确保你正确理解了API的使用方法。
- 使用代码审查工具:使用代码审查工具检查代码质量,减少代码错误。
在解决这些问题时,记住,耐心和细致是关键。有时候,一个小小的错误就能导致整个集成过程出现问题。因此,在遇到问题时,不要慌张,一步步地排查,最终找到解决问题的方法。
最后,建议你在集成过程中做好备份,这样在遇到问题时可以快速恢复到之前的状态。同时,定期更新你的知识库,了解最新的技术动态和最佳实践,这有助于你更有效地解决问题。
卡尔云官网
www.kaeryun.com